Rapid Microbiology Testing Market: Market Size & Forecast 2026

The Rapid Microbiology Testing Market enables faster detection and identification of microorganisms than traditional culture-based methods, using technologies such as PCR, mass spectrometry, immunoassays, and next-generation sequencing. Valued at approximately $6.1 billion in 2025, the market is projected to grow at a compound annual rate of around 8.6%, driven by rising infectious disease burdens, stricter food safety regulations, and pharmaceutical industry demands for quicker sterility testing. North America leads in market share, while the Asia-Pacific region is expected to see the fastest expansion, fueled by improving healthcare infrastructure and growing laboratory capacity.

Market Overview

Rapid microbiology testing encompasses a range of analytical techniques that significantly shorten the time required to detect, identify, and quantify microorganisms compared to conventional plating and culture methods, which can take days to weeks. The market spans clinical diagnostics, pharmaceutical manufacturing, food and beverage safety, environmental monitoring, and cosmetics applications, serving hospitals, diagnostic laboratories, food processing facilities, and research institutions.

  • Market valued at approximately $6.1 billion in 2025, with a projected CAGR of ~8.6% over the coming years
  • Core technologies include real-time PCR, MALDI-TOF mass spectrometry, ATP bioluminescence, immunoassays, and next-generation sequencing
  • Serves multiple verticals: clinical diagnostics, pharmaceutical QC, food safety, and environmental monitoring

Growth Drivers

The escalating global burden of infectious diseases and the need for timely, point-of-care diagnostic results remain primary catalysts for market expansion. Additionally, stringent regulatory requirements for food safety and pharmaceutical sterility testing, combined with growing awareness of hospital-acquired infections, have pushed healthcare and industrial sectors toward faster microbiological workflows.

  • Rising incidence of infectious and hospital-acquired infections demands quicker turnaround for antimicrobial susceptibility testing and pathogen identification
  • Food safety regulations such as the U.S. FSMA and EU hygiene standards mandate efficient microbial screening across the supply chain
  • Pharmaceutical and biopharmaceutical companies increasingly adopt rapid methods for sterility testing and bioburden analysis to accelerate product release cycles

Segmentation and Regional Analysis

The market is commonly segmented by product type, instruments, reagents and consumables, and software, as well as by testing method, end-user industry, and geography. North America currently holds the largest market share due to advanced healthcare infrastructure, strong regulatory frameworks, and high adoption of innovative technologies, while Asia-Pacific is anticipated to register the highest growth rate as healthcare systems expand and laboratory modernization accelerates.

  • By method: PCR-based testing commands a significant share, followed by mass spectrometry and immunoassay platforms
  • By application: clinical diagnostics and pharmaceutical quality control together represent the largest revenue segments
  • Asia-Pacific is the fastest-growing region, with China, India, and Japan driving expansion through increased lab investments and infectious disease surveillance

Trends and Outlook

What are the recent trends and outlook?

Miniaturization, microfluidics, and artificial intelligence-enhanced data interpretation are emerging trends poised to reshape the rapid microbiology testing landscape over the next several years. The growing emphasis on antimicrobial resistance surveillance, expansion of molecular diagnostics, and post-pandemic strengthening of public health laboratory networks are expected to sustain robust market momentum through 2030 and beyond.

  • Integration of AI and machine learning for automated pathogen identification and susceptibility prediction is gaining traction across diagnostic platforms
  • Point-of-care molecular testing and portable sequencing devices are broadening access outside of centralized laboratory settings
  • Increasing focus on One Health approaches, linking human, animal, and environmental microbiology, is driving cross-sector adoption of rapid testing solutions
